I have a 2010 Jeep Commander runs a 245 65 r17 tire I
found a deal on wheels and tires off of a 2020 gladiator
that are 245 75 r17 can I put those on my commander
without any issues? Thanks in advance.

3 Answers

295

You should be fine that's not much of a jump in size. your old tires are 29.5 inches tall while the tires you want are 31.5 tall and that is only a 6.8% difference when i was a service manger anything under 10% was ok. if will affect you Speedometer by a few miles.
